Word: Ascesis
Speech Type: Noun
Etymology:
late 19th century: from Greek askēsis ‘training’, from askein ‘to exercise’
Audio Pronunciation:
Phonetic Spelling:
əˈsiːsɪs
Dialects: British English
Definition:
the practice of severe self-discipline, typically for religious reasons.
Short Definition:practice of severe self-discipline
Variant Forms:
- askesis
